hidden attenna recommendations?

I may need to replace windshield soon, but I heard the better route may be a powered internal antenna ( & Cheaper glass) rather than the pricey windshield with the marginal antenna built in.

Does anyone have any experience with these? the last relevant post i found was from 2003.

I used one of those fairly inexpensive powered ones that you stick on the windshield in a prior 911. A piece of black plastic maybe 8 inches long or so. It worked about the same as the factory "in the glass" antenna in my current 911 (i.e., marginal, as you point out, but workable).

Years ago I found one at Radio Shack. It was in a clear tape, like scotch tape. that I ran up the outside and top of the windshield up to the rear view mirror. It's worked for at least 10 years.
